Oh, how the tables have turned. A Certis Cisco enforcement officer was suspended after he was spotted smoking at a void deck and casually tossing the cigarette butt aside on Saturday (Nov 21), shortly after he tried to prevent a pair of delivery men from stopping at the loading and unloading bay at Woodlands Avenue 6. Video clips of his actions were uploaded onto Facebook the same evening by one of the affected delivery riders along with the caption: «Enforcing the law. Breaking the law.» In the first clip, the officer was seen calmly telling the delivery man behind the camera that he was not allowed to park where he was, despite the latter pointing out that he had stationed his vehicle at the loading and unloading bay. Another delivery rider strode over with a similar complaint, saying that the officer had noted down his license plate number too. The officer maintained his stance, telling them: «Loading bay is not allowed for delivery. You have to go to the car park. And I didn't tell you that you can't do delivery.
